On the morning of March 27, 2026, Phuoc Thanh joined the University of Architecture Ho Chi Minh City (UAH) in a series of events on Transit-Oriented Development (TOD) – an urban development model integrated with public transportation systems.

The event series features exhibitions, seminars, and networking activities, all centered on urban development oriented around public transport. A key highlight is the exhibition “UAH in Motion with TOD”, showcasing 25 outstanding design projects from the Faculties of Architecture, Urban Planning, Fine Arts, Urban Infrastructure Engineering, and the Institute of International Education, along with 25 in-depth theses and dissertations by postgraduate students and researchers.

The program also explores TOD implementation in Ho Chi Minh City, experiences from metro development, the integration of planning, infrastructure, and urban space, as well as land value optimization.
